Alexander the Great

Alexander the Great is considered one of history’s most successful military commanders! By the time he was thirty he controlled the largest empire the ancient world had ever seen. His reign lasted from 336 BC to 323 BC and even though he was still very young when he died he managed to connect and influence a vast area as never before.

Gold coins struck by Alexander are called gold staters and silver coins are called silver tetradrachms. These are some of the most well-known coins of the ancient world. He also issued a small amount of the impressive distaters, or double staters, that were thought to be used as payment to his most trusted soldiers.
